Airbnb Real Estate Tips for Maximizing Your Investment
When you invest in real estate with the intention of listing on Airbnb, there are several key factors to consider. These tips will help you make smart decisions and increase your chances of success.
1. Location is Everything
Choose properties in areas with high demand for short-term rentals. Tourist hotspots, business hubs, and places near universities or hospitals tend to attract more guests. Research local regulations to ensure short-term rentals are allowed.
2. Understand Your Target Market
Are you catering to vacationers, business travelers, or families? Tailor your property’s amenities and decor to meet their needs. For example, business travelers may appreciate a dedicated workspace and fast Wi-Fi.
3. Optimize Your Listing
High-quality photos, detailed descriptions, and competitive pricing are essential. Highlight unique features like a pool, proximity to attractions, or a cozy fireplace. Respond promptly to inquiries to boost your ratings.
4. Manage Costs Wisely
Factor in cleaning fees, maintenance, utilities, and Airbnb service charges. Budget for occasional repairs and upgrades to keep your property attractive.
5. Use Technology to Your Advantage
Automate bookings, messaging, and pricing with tools designed for Airbnb hosts. This saves time and helps you stay competitive.

What is the 80 20 Rule for Airbnb?
The 80 20 rule, also known as the Pareto Principle, applies to Airbnb hosting by suggesting that 80% of your results come from 20% of your efforts. Understanding this can help you focus on the most impactful activities.
Key applications of the 80 20 rule in Airbnb hosting include:
Guest Experience: 80% of positive reviews often come from 20% of your best efforts, such as cleanliness and communication. Prioritize these to boost your reputation.
Pricing Strategy: 20% of your pricing adjustments may generate 80% of your bookings. Experiment with rates during peak and off-peak seasons.
Property Maintenance: Focus on the 20% of maintenance tasks that prevent 80% of issues, like regular HVAC servicing and plumbing checks.
By identifying and prioritizing these critical areas, you can maximize your Airbnb rental’s profitability with less effort.

How to Choose the Right Property for Airbnb
Selecting the right property is crucial for success. Here are some practical steps to guide your decision:
1. Analyze Market Demand
Use Airbnb’s market data or third-party tools to identify neighborhoods with high occupancy rates and average daily rates.
2. Check Local Regulations
Some cities have strict rules on short-term rentals. Verify zoning laws, licensing requirements, and any restrictions to avoid legal issues.
3. Evaluate Property Features
Look for properties with appealing features such as multiple bedrooms, parking, outdoor space, and easy access to public transport.
4. Consider Property Management
If you don’t live nearby, hiring a property manager or co-host can help maintain the property and handle guest communications.
5. Calculate Potential Returns
Estimate your income based on average occupancy and nightly rates, then subtract expenses to determine your net profit.
By carefully selecting a property that fits these criteria, you set yourself up for a successful Airbnb rental.
Managing Your Airbnb Property Like a Pro
Effective management is key to maintaining high occupancy and positive reviews. Here are some actionable recommendations:
Create a Welcome Guide: Include house rules, local attractions, and emergency contacts. This enhances guest experience and reduces confusion.
Maintain Cleanliness: Hire professional cleaners or use reliable cleaning services between stays. Cleanliness is one of the top factors for guest satisfaction.
Communicate Promptly: Respond quickly to inquiries and messages. Use automated responses for common questions to save time.
Regularly Update Your Listing: Refresh photos and descriptions to reflect any upgrades or changes. Keep pricing competitive by monitoring local market trends.
Solicit Feedback: Encourage guests to leave reviews and use their feedback to improve your property and service.

Why Real Estate Investing Airbnb is a Smart Move
Combining real estate investing with Airbnb can significantly increase your returns compared to traditional long-term rentals. Here’s why:
Higher Income Potential: Short-term rentals often command higher nightly rates than monthly leases.
Flexibility: You can use the property yourself during off-peak times or when it’s not rented.
Diversification: Airbnb allows you to diversify your income streams and reduce reliance on a single tenant.
Market Adaptability: You can adjust pricing and availability based on demand, maximizing revenue.
Tax Benefits: Depending on your location, you may qualify for tax deductions related to property expenses and depreciation.

Building a Sustainable Airbnb Business
To ensure long-term success, treat your Airbnb rental as a business. Here are some tips to build sustainability:
Invest in Quality Furnishings: Durable and attractive furniture reduces replacement costs and appeals to guests.
Stay Informed on Market Trends: Keep up with changes in travel patterns, local laws, and competitor offerings.
Develop a Strong Brand: Create a unique style and guest experience that sets your property apart.
Plan for Seasonality: Prepare for slow seasons by offering discounts or targeting different guest segments.
Maintain Financial Records: Track income and expenses carefully to understand profitability and plan for growth.
By adopting a professional approach, you can turn your Airbnb property into a reliable and profitable investment.
